Kwara Governor Emphasises National Security in AI Development

Date: 2024-08-22

According to a news report from Blueprint, Kwara State Governor AbdulRahman AbdulRazaq has issued a challenge to the newly inaugurated National Executive Committee of the Nigeria Foundation for Artificial Intelligence ( NFAI ), urging them to prioritise national security and the strengthening of humanity in their AI-related endeavours.

In a congratulatory message to the new executive committee members, particularly Mallam Taofik Abdulkareem, a Kwaran and chairman/CEO of Plat Technologies Limited, Governor AbdulRazaq stressed the importance of putting public interest and national security at the forefront of their agenda.

He called on all stakeholders to actively pursue a national consensus on internet governance and the ethical use of AI, with a particular focus on economic growth, trade, investment, and inclusivity, while always safeguarding national interests.
